TitleLetter from Thomas Jarrett to Madras Corresponding Committee: 6 April 1818: Madras
Extent1 doc.
Date1818
DescriptionPresents copies of address and St. Matthew's Gospel in Hebrew, published in one volume, for transmission to Jews in Travancore; believes that Jews will have the restoration of their fatherland in the present century and it is therefore necessary for them to be given gospel in their own language, Hebrew; the Society for Promoting Christianity amongst the Jews published in Hebrew St. Matthew's Gospel in 1813; Jarrett has distributed some of these; asked Moses Sargone to report on Jews in Travancore and Cochin; there are white Jews at Cochin and black Jews at Cochin, Cheriotta, Parvor near Cranganoro, Malla, Tritoor and Moodat; quotes previous books on subject and comments on possibility of some Cochin Jews being descended from the ten tribes of Israel [copy].
